How Our Cabinet Water Damage Repair Process Works
Our team follows a meticulous process to ensure a thorough and efficient restoration. Proper drying techniques prevent further damage and extend the lifespan of your cabinets. We take pride in our work and our customers appreciate the attention to detail.
Step 1: Inspection and Assessment
Our technicians inspect your property to identify the source and extent of the damage. We use specialized equipment to detect hidden water pockets and assess the moisture levels in your cabinets.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We use industrial-grade pumps and vacuums to remove standing water from your cabinets. Our goal is to dry the area quickly to prevent further damage and reduce the risk of mold growth.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We employ specialized drying equipment to remove excess moisture from your cabinets and surrounding areas. Our technicians monitor the drying process to ensure it’s completed efficiently.
Step 4: Cabinet Restoration
Once the drying process is complete, our technicians restore your cabinets to their original condition. We use high-quality materials to match the original finish and ensure a seamless repair.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Cleaning
Our team conducts a final inspection to ensure your property is completely dry and free of any remaining moisture. We also clean and disinfect the area to prevent future mold growth.

Warning Signs You Need Cabinet Water Damage Repair
Recognizing the warning signs of water damage can save you time, money, and stress. Act fast to prevent further damage and reduce the risk of costly repairs.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, unpleasant odors in your cabinets or surrounding areas can show hidden water damage. Don’t ignore these signs as they can lead to further damage and health risks.
Warped or Discolored Cabinets
Water damage can cause your cabinets to warp, discolor, or develop uneven finishes. Address these issues quickly to prevent further damage and extend the lifespan of your cabinets.
Visible Water Stains or Leaks
Visible water stains or leaks on your cabinets or surrounding areas need immediate attention. Don’t delay in addressing these issues, as they can lead to further damage and health risks.
Increased Humidity or Moisture
Unusual humidity or moisture levels in your cabinets or surrounding areas can show hidden water damage. Monitor these levels closely to prevent further damage and reduce the risk of mold growth.
Cracks or Fissures in Cabinets
Cracks or fissures in your cabinets can show water damage or structural issues. Address these issues quickly to prevent further damage and extend the lifespan of your cabinets.
Unusual Sounds or Creaks
Unusual sounds or creaks in your cabinets or surrounding areas can show hidden water damage or structural issues. Don’t ignore these signs as they can lead to further damage and health risks.

Cabinet Water Damage Repair Cost in McLean, VA
The cost of cabinet water damage repair varies based on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ions in McLean, VA. Get a free estimate to find out the exact cost of your repair.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ions |
| Cabinet restoration and repair |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of cabinets, and complexity of repair |
| Moisture testing and inspection |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area and complexity of inspection |
| Dehumidification and drying equipment rental |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area and duration of rental |
| Disinfection and sanitizing |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area and type of disinfection required |
| Final inspection and certification |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area and complexity of inspection |
